How to fill out the IL HFS 3416B online
The IL HFS 3416B form, formally known as the Voluntary Acknowledgment of Paternity, is essential for legally establishing the relationship between a biological father and a child when the biological father is not married to the child's mother. This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ions on how to accurately complete the form online.
Follow the steps to complete the IL HFS 3416B online.
- Click the 'Get Form' button to access the IL HFS 3416B form and open it for editing.
- Begin by filling out the child's information section. Provide the child's full name as it will appear on the birth certificate, including their first name, middle name (if applicable), last name, date of birth, gender, and place of birth.
- Next, enter the biological father's information. Fill in their first name, middle name (if any), last name, date of birth, and place of birth. Additionally, include their address and daytime phone number.
- Proceed to the biological mother's section. Input her first name, middle name (if applicable), last name, date of birth, place of birth, address, current last name, maiden name, and daytime phone number.
- Indicate whether the biological mother was married to or in a civil union with someone other than the child's biological father when the child was born or within 300 days prior. If 'yes', provide the presumed parent's name.
- Review the rights and responsibilities specified in the form. Ensure that both parents understand that by signing the VAP, they acknowledge their legal relationship to the child and understand the implications.
- Each parent must sign the form in front of a witness who is at least 18 years old. The witness cannot be a parent or the child named on the form.
- Once the form is fully completed and signed, double-check all entries for accuracy. It's important that all items are answered, and signatures are present.
- Submit the original signed form by mailing it to the Administrative Coordination Unit (ACU) at the specified address. Do not send photocopies as only original documents are accepted.
- After mailing, you may wish to save the filled form as a PDF or print a copy for your records. You could also share the completed form with relevant parties if necessary.

Legitimation refers to the legal process of making a child legitimate, often through marriage of parents, while acknowledgment is a specific declaration of paternity. Under IL HFS 3416B, acknowledgment is a voluntary act that validates the father's relationship with the child. Both processes ensure the child's legal status is secure, but they operate differently.
